Christian Affairs Office Clears Gov. Bala Mohammed of Banditry Allegations
By Mubarak Aliyu Kobi
The Office of the Senior Special Assistant to the Executive Governor of Bauchi State on Christian Religious Affairs has dismissed as false and malicious allegations linking Governor Bala Abdulkadir Mohammed to the sponsorship of banditry or any form of insecurity.
In an official communiqué issued on Saturday, the office described the claims as baseless, unfounded, and deliberately misleading, noting that they are aimed at undermining public confidence in lawful authority and constituted leadership in the state.
The statement categorically stressed that at no time and under no circumstance has Governor Bala Abdulkadir Mohammed, throughout his tenure as Executive Governor of Bauchi State, sponsored, supported, encouraged, or condoned banditry, insecurity, or criminal activities of any kind.
According to the communiqué, the allegations do not reflect the reality on ground, as the Governor has consistently demonstrated decisive, lawful, and proactive leadership in addressing security and governance challenges across the state.
It added that the Bala Mohammed administration remains firmly committed to the protection of lives and property, the maintenance of law and order, and the promotion of peace, unity, and stability in Bauchi State.
The office further noted that it is a matter of verifiable public record that the Governor governs with equity, fairness, and inclusiveness, ensuring equal treatment for Christians, indigenous communities, non-indigenous residents, and all ethnic and religious groups without discrimination.
As the Senior Special Assistant on Christian Religious Affairs, the office disclosed that it maintains documented engagements and verifiable evidence of the Governor’s sustained interventions and tangible achievements within the Christian community, underscoring his commitment to inclusive governance and religious harmony.
The office therefore condemned the allegations in the strongest terms and reaffirmed its total and unwavering support for Governor Bala Abdulkadir Mohammed, describing his administration as progressive, just, and firmly anchored on unity, security, and responsible governance.
